Thylacocephala

Thylacocephala jsou skupina vyhynulých členovců, kteří žili v průběhu paleozoika a mezozoika. Stratigrafický záznam linie Thylacocephala začíná možná již v kambriu, nesporní zástupci se objevují v siluru v sedimentech z dob před asi 443 až 430 miliony lety.
